Detection principle

The color depth of the generated quinones is directly proportional to the triglyceride content. The absorbance values of the standard tube and the sample tube are measured respectively, and the triglyceride content in the sample can be calculated.

Performance characteristics

Synonyms TG
Sample type Serum,plasma,tissue
Sensitivity 0.19 mmol/L
Detection range 0.19-8.0 mmol/L
Detection method Colorimetric method
Assay type Quantitative
Assay time 50 min
Precision Average inter-assay CV: 6.700%Average intra-assay CV: 2.400%
Storage 2-8℃
Valid period 12 months

Dilution of sample

It is recommended to take 2~3 samples with expected large difference to do pre-experiment before formal experiment and dilute the sample according to the result of the pre-experiment and the detection range (0.19-8.0 mmol/L).

The recommended dilution factor for different samples is as follows (for reference only):

Sample type

Dilution factor

Human serum

1

Mouse serum

1

Rat plasma

1

10% Rat liver tissue homogenate

1

10% Rat kidney tissue homogenate

1

10% Mouse brain tissue homogenate

1

Note: The diluent is normal saline (0.9% NaCl) or PBS (0.01 M, pH 7.4) for serum (plasma) samples;   The diluent is anhydrous ethanol for tissue samples.
